Reviewing: Sula Sugar Free, Eucalyptus Flavor

This is another German-made medication I have discovered and tried during my trip to Europe. When I had gotten a sore throat, I began to look for something like Halls Mentho Lyptus cough drops - that's what I usually buy in the US, and the drops work like magic. I found a similar product called Sula.

Sula cough drops are sugar-free, approved for those with diabetes. They also contain Vitamin C; the packaging says that 7-8 drops will meet your daily need for Vitamin C. The drops come in several flavors, I bought the one with eucalyptus. I paid around $1.50 for a 60 gram pack. The pack had about 20 drops, each one in a separate wrapper, just like Halls. The drops look very much like candy, round and light-green in color. They taste sweet despite being sugar-free, and very refreshing. The eucalyptus flavor is very close to that of Halls cough drops with eucalyptus, and so is the effect: my sore throat stopped hurting after the first drop, and each drop gave me immediate cough relief.

I was very happy that I had found Sula, this German alternative to Halls works very well.
